The Foundation: Advanced Pocket Spring Support

At the core of superior mattress support is the pocket spring system. Unlike traditional interconnected spring units, individual pocket springs move independently. This design is crucial for minimizing motion transfer and providing targeted support and pressure relief to different body regions. The use of 1.8mm diameter wire in a high-count configuration ensures both resilience and longevity. Comfort Layer Innovation: Breathable Fabrics and Adaptive Foam

Directly influencing comfort and temperature regulation are the top layers. A high-density 270gsm knit fabric promotes airflow, a critical factor often emphasized by users in sleep communities. Beneath this, a choice of gel-infused memory foam or standard foam addresses different sleep preferences. Gel memory foam, in particular, is designed to dissipate heat, a common complaint with traditional memory foam noted in Reddit discussions like this January 2022 thread on r/Mattress debating its value. These materials create a body-adapting cushion that relieves pressure points without sacrificing support.
